[[Big Brain]] Differents who are an integral part of the [[think.Net]] system. They serve the function of data management. The [[Telepath]]s involved in [[think.Net]] essentially receive all of the thoughts occurring in a designated area. The Librarians can parse through these thoughts for users who are communicating using [[think.Net]], and then those thoughts can be exchanged between the two intended users. Without using the Librarians, the [[Telepath]]s would not be able to make sense of the jumble of thoughts they receive.
 
   
 
   
 
Librarians are also used to store and access information through [[think.Net]] including recorded visual input callrf [[Tell-Watching]], archives of Pre[[Plague]] entertainment, banking information, information services for business, and many more.
